A '''Cue Ball''' or '''Roughneck''' (Japanese: '''スキンヘッズ''' ''Skinhead'') is a type of [[Pokémon Trainer]] that first debuted in the [[Generation I]] games.  They appear as gigantic, hulking bald men.  Cue Balls are usually in the vicinity of [[Biker]]s. Their Diamond/Pearl appearance has a {{p|Gyarados}} on the back of the vest, much similar to most gangs, indicating they might be thugs of some sort. Their name may be hinting to the white billiards ball.


They specialize in a combination of {{t|Poison}}-[[type]] and {{t|Fighting}}-[[type]] [[Pokémon]] and are sometimes shown as being affiliated with [[Team Rocket]].
